What the vulnerability does
01Description
Improper Neutralization of Input During Web Page Generation ('Cross-site Scripting') vulnerability in BlueGlass Interactive AG Jobs for WordPress job-postings allows Stored XSS.This issue affects Jobs for WordPress: from n/a through <= 2.8.1.
Explanation of Vulnerability in Simple Terms
02Summary
The Jobs for WordPress plugin contains a stored c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ability in versions up to 2.8.1. An authenticated user with low privileges can inject malicious scripts that execute in the browsers of other site visitors, including administrators. The vulnerability requires user interaction to trigger. Attackers can steal session tokens, modify page content, or perform actions on behalf of affected users.
What an attacker can do
03Attacker Capabilities
Inject malicious scripts that run in other users' browsers and steal their session data or perform actions as them.
Potential impact on your site
04Site Impact
Administrators and other users visiting affected pages could have their sessions hijacked or be tricked into performing unintended actions.
Conditions required to exploit
05Prerequisites
Attacker must have a low-privilege WordPress account and trick a site visitor into viewing a page containing the malicious payload.
